North Korea Conducts Hypersonic Missile Drills Under Kim Jong Un’s Supervision

 



PYONGYANG – The Democratic People's Republic of Korea (DPRK) has announced the successful conduct of missile exercises involving hypersonic weaponry, aimed at verifying the combat readiness and mobility of its strategic forces.

Key Details of the Launch

According to a report by the Korean Central News Agency (KCNA), the drills took place yesterday in the Yeokpho region. The hypersonic missiles were launched in a northeasterly direction, traveling approximately 1,000 km before successfully striking their designated targets.

The primary objectives of the exercise included:

  • System Assessment: Evaluating the readiness of hypersonic weapon systems.

  • Combat Verification: Confirming the operational capabilities and mobility of the deterrent forces.

  • Personnel Training: Training missile units in real-world fire application.


Strategic Context and Kim Jong Un’s Remarks

North Korean leader Kim Jong Un personally oversaw the launches. He emphasized that the frequent demonstration of the North's strategic strike capabilities is a "vital and effective way to deter war."

"Recent geopolitical crises and international events explain why these measures are necessary," Kim stated, likely referencing the ongoing situation in Venezuela.

He further noted that these tests serve to consistently strengthen the nation's nuclear deterrent. Kim highlighted recent progress in the practical application of nuclear weaponry and called for the continuous modernization of offensive systems to stay ahead of global security shifts.



Technical Analysis

While Pyongyang did not officially name the specific missile system used, defense analysts suggest it may be the Hwasong-11D/Ma (화성-11마). This short-range ballistic missile is equipped with a Hypersonic Glide Vehicle (HGV) and was first tested in October of last year.

The nature of yesterday's flight path suggests a focus on testing low-altitude gliding capabilities and extended range performance.

Leadership Presence

Accompanying Kim Jong Un at the launch were high-ranking defense officials, including:

  • Kim Jong Sik: First Deputy Director of the WPK Defense Industry Department.

  • Jang Chang Ha: Head of the General Missile Bureau.
